Storms loom over Türkiye as rain threatens several regions

May 12, 2025 09:56 AM GMT+03:00

According to the latest forecasts from the Turkish State Meteorological Service, much of Türkiye will experience cloudy weather today, with scattered showers and thunderstorms predicted across wide swathes of the country.

Regions at particular risk include the southern and eastern parts of Central Anatolia, Central and Eastern Black Sea, Eastern Anatolia, northeastern and eastern parts of Southeastern Anatolia, and parts of Thrace, including Edirne and Kirklareli.

Heavy rainfall warning for Central and Eastern Türkiye

Forecasters warn that localized heavy rain is likely in eastern Central Anatolia, the Eastern Black Sea region, and the northern parts of Eastern Anatolia. Areas around Tokat may also be affected by strong showers and possible thunderstorms.

Temperatures to stay seasonal

Despite the unsettled conditions, temperatures are expected to remain around seasonal averages throughout the country, with no major shifts predicted in the coming days.
